James Wellbeloved Dog Puppy Hypo...

Pros

  • Named turkey as sole animal protein — no vague 'meat derivatives' or by-products
  • Hypoallergenic formula excluding 6 common allergens (beef, pork, soya, eggs, dairy, wheat)
  • Vet-recommended in reviews for puppies with sensitive stomachs or digestive issues
  • Added chondroitin and glucosamine support healthy joint development from early age

Cons

  • Contains rice — not suitable for puppies requiring a grain-free diet
  • 2 kg bag may be costly per kg compared to standard non-hypoallergenic puppy foods
  • Full ingredient list not visible in listing — exact protein and fat percentages unconfirmed from available data
  • Single protein source limits dietary variety; long-term single-protein feeding may reduce tolerance over time

Best For

Puppies with food allergies or sensitivities Puppies with sensitive stomachs or recurring digestive issues Small and medium breed puppies Owners seeking vet-recommended hypoallergenic options Puppies transitioning away from allergen-heavy foods

Lily’s Kitchen Made with Natural...

Pros

  • Named chicken as primary protein — freshly prepared, not rendered or meal-based per brand claims
  • Visible meat, vegetables, and herbs reported by owners; no jelly filler like cheaper alternatives
  • Excellent palatability — most dogs eat eagerly and show excitement at feeding time
  • No reported digestive issues; well-tolerated across multiple reviews

Cons

  • Premium price point — among the more expensive puppy wet foods per 100g; several reviewers flag cost as a barrier
  • Portion size per tray (150g) may be insufficient as sole feeding for larger breed puppies, requiring multiple trays per meal
  • A small number of dogs lost interest after initial enthusiasm — palatability may not be consistent long-term for fussy eaters
  • Spec data indicates meat meal present, which contradicts brand marketing claims — ingredient list should be verified on-pack before purchase

Best For

Puppies aged 8–14 months transitioning from breeder diets to natural food Owners switching from additive-heavy brands (Pedigree, supermarket own-brand) to cleaner options Puppies with sensitive digestion or low tolerance to artificial additives Teething puppies needing soft, palatable wet food Owners who prioritise ingredient transparency and natural sourcing
